RTI International Invests in Healthcare Technology Companies b.well Connected Health and BEKhealth

RTI International announced 2 new collaborations and equity investments with b.well Connected Health, a Fast Healthcare Interoperability Resources–enabled digital platform that unifies fragmented healthcare data and services into personalized digital experiences, and BEKhealth, an AI-powered chart abstraction and patient-matching platform that integrates electronic health records data to optimize feasibility and rapidly identify clinically qualified participants for clinical research.

The new partnerships align with RTI Health Solutions' business unit’s strategic initiative to leverage technology and data to maximize impact on patient outcomes. Additionally, these capabilities will enable all RTI’s health businesses to further incorporate patient-level real-world data into their research to provide clients with meaningful insights into changes, trends, and causal relationships over time.

About RTI International

RTI International is an independent, nonprofit research institute dedicated to improving the human condition. Clients rely on us to answer questions that demand an objective and multidisciplinary approach—one that integrates expertise across the social and laboratory sciences, engineering, and international development. About RTI Health Solutions

As a business unit of RTI International, RTI Health Solutions (RTI-HS) provides consulting, communications, and research expertise to pharmaceutical, biotechnology, diagnostics, and medical device companies. Located across the US and Europe, our staff have led projects in approximately 80 countries. Our solutions include: 

  • Medical Strategy and Communications
  • Patient-Centered Research
  • Real-World Evidence
  • Regulatory and Safety
  • Strategic Consulting
  • Value, Access, and HEOR
